<p>What is Cast Aluminum?</p> <p><a href="https://www.easiahome.com/">Cast aluminum</a> is a type of aluminum that has been melted and poured into a mold to create a desired shape. It is known for its lightweight nature, corrosion resistance, and excellent thermal conductivity. Cast aluminum is commonly used in industries such as automotive, aerospace, and construction due to its strength-to-weight ratio and durability.</p> <p>One of the key advantages of cast aluminum is its low density, which makes it lighter than cast iron. This characteristic is particularly beneficial in applications where weight reduction is essential, such as in the manufacturing of automobiles and aircraft. Additionally, cast aluminum exhibits good corrosion resistance, making it suitable for outdoor applications that are exposed to environmental elements.</p>
